HR Avatar's New AI Features

The future of AI is humans empowered by AIWe are rolling out AI-driven features to enhance the information our assessments and reference checks provide. You may already have noticed new insights in your reports.

All of the following enhancements are at least partially implemented today and will be fully available by the end of 2025:

  1. Essay and Text Scoring

    AI is used to produce both numeric and qualitative scores for written responses using the same standards as a human evaluator. In addition to an overall score, the system scores clarity, structure, and grammar, then provides a short rationale explaining strengths and areas for improvement.

  2. Video and Voice Analysis

    Recorded and live interviews are transcribed and analyzed using AI. Content is scored in a way similar to essay text (above). Additionally, speech patterns such as tone, pacing, and pausing are measured to predict how a candidate’s communication may be perceived.

  3. Resume Upload and Parsing

    Customers can request that a candidate or employee upload a resume as part of an assessment or reference check. AI is used to parse and summarize the uploaded resumes. Their resume is then used in conjunction with other scores to perform higher-order AI scoring (described below).

  4. Higher-Order AI-Powered Scoring

    In addition to question-level AI scoring and document parsing, HR Avatar now supports higher-order AI evaluations that analyze all collected candidate data (resumes, test scores, reference check scores) against your company’s defined information.

    • Company Culture Alignment
      AI can compare a candidate or employee with your pre-defined company culture and values. AI also parses company-provided materials to summarize and establish culture information.
    • Core Competency Comparison
      AI evaluates candidates against your organization’s pre-defined core competencies. AI summarizes and structures the provided competency information, generating comparison scores that highlight alignment and development opportunities.
    • Job Description Match
      AI estimates how well candidates align with one or more job descriptions specified by your company, both quantitatively and qualitatively. These scores are produced automatically when a job description is mapped to a specific assessment or test key. Job Description Match scores are also hard coded into all of our job-specific tests, which allows you to receive a score without needing to input a job description.
    • Personality and KSA Summaries
      AI can generate summaries of personality and other non-cognitive traits measured within an assessment. It also summarizes knowledge, skills, and abilities (KSAs) drawn from assessment scores and resumes when available. These summaries present areas of high competence and areas for improvement in the context of workplace performance. They are automatically generated when sufficient scores are available and no other high-order evaluations are performed.

Each AI-generated evaluation includes a clear rationale describing strengths, weaknesses, and avenues for improvement.

Maximizing the Value of AI
The more company-specific information you add, the more meaningful and personalized your AI summaries will be. These features are designed to enhance your evaluations, not replace your decision-making.

Think of HR Avatar’s AI as a second opinion. It connects the dots between data points, highlights key insights, and helps ensure every candidate is seen as a whole person.
